Hi Kenny,

Everyone worldwide has access to the internet, nice people and not nice people. Many posters live in places where persecution is rampant; not only from governments but from theological cemeteries of christendom also. Privacy of some kind is always the prerogative of the individual, if one wishes they can go totally public or stay in anonymity. I am explaining this way because you state that you are new to the internet and may not be aware of this.

I just wanted to commet on why I chose winner08. We lost everything when Katrina hit. the house, the car and truck. all our clothes. When I say everything we owned that's is just what I mean, everything. Whatever we had on our backs when we evac is what we had when we got back to New Orleans. Aug. 05 is when we lost everything. It took 3 yrs just to get some since of stability. Some since of being safe again. Not just from the weather but just to have a place to call home and not living in a fema trailer. Anyway in 08 things started to get better. I said 08, this will be my yr. I found a home and bought a truck things started to look good. So that's why I use winner08, Its more than just a name, It has a very deep meaning to me. But I think the others are right when they say it just might have something to do with privacy issues.
